At start-up, if the frequency reaches the brake
Hz
release frequency, the torque reaches the brake
release torque, and the current reaches the brake
%
release current, then the open brake condition is
%
met and the brake is opened.
Starting from the start time, if the brake has not
Hz
reached the condition of the brake open after the
time reaches the set time of H0.16, the torque
%
verification fault is reported.
%
H0.07 ≥ H0.01, H0.08 ≥ H0.04, after the frequency
Hz
reaches the delay frequency, the frequency is
maintained at the brake delay frequency. If the
Hz
brake open condition is reached, the brake open
s
command is sent after the delay of H0.09 setting,
and the acceleration is continued to the given
s
frequency after delaying the H0.10 setting.
When decelerating, if the frequency is less than the
Hz
brake closing frequency, the inverter sends an
Hz
instruction to close the brake.
H0.11≥H0.13, H0.12≥H0.14, when decelerating, if
Hz
the frequency drops to the slip delay frequency, the
slip delay frequency is maintained, and after the
Hz
slip delay time is reached, the speed is decelerated
Hz
to 0.
s
Detection delay time from start to brake open
If the brake feedback is enabled (bit 12 of H0.00),
when the inverter control brake is released, the
brake feedback signal is closed; when the inverter
control brake is closed, the brake feedback signal
is open.
s
The feedback signal is connected to the X terminal
and the function is 32: Brake release confirmation
If the inverter sends a brake command and the
brake feedback is inconsistent, the brake is faulty
after the brake failure detection time.
